Join the quest to find all of the special ingredients needed for the harvest festival told through puppetry, and interactive miniature/life-size sets.

Leah Ogawa is a mixed-race artist, puppeteer, dramatist, self-detective, and model based in New York City. Raised in Yamanashi, Japan, Leah has worked with puppeteers, artists, and companies including The Metropolitan Opera, Phantom Limb, Dan Hurlin, Tom Lee, Nami Yamamoto, Loco7, and others. John Tsung is a musician, writer, and multidisciplinary artist based in New York City. Tsung's records, scores, writing, and installations address the nature of sound and memory.  As an Asian immigrant raised in Hong Kong, Taiwan, and Texas, Tsung's music is influenced by his classical training, electronic music background, as well as the Norteño and country music of his adoptive home.
